Introduction of the fundamental elements of effective project management and provides students with the opportunity to apply these elements using exercises and examples based on real-time projects. The tools and techniques used to plan, measure, and control projects, as well as the methods used to organize and manage projects, are also discussed. Focus is on developing project managers who can find the right people to do the right work at the right time, and for these people to make the right decisions. If you intend to certify as a Project Management Professional (PMP)®, initiate contact with the Project Management Institute at www.pmi.org and/or your local PMI® chapter.

Project Management Organizational Framework covers principles and practices presented in the Project Management Body of Knowledge (PMBOK® Guide) developed by the Project Management Institute (PMI) Standards Committee. This guide addresses such organizational and structural issues as scope, time management, human resource planning, and project communications, and serves as the foundation for the project manager certification areas of competency.

PMIF completes the topics presented in the Project Management Institute's Project Management Body of Knowledge and includes project cost, quality, procurement, and risk management. Continuing the work from PMOF, PMIF provides students with additional opportunities to apply these concepts using real-life exercises and examples. Special consideration is given to preparing students for the Project Management Professional (PMP)® certification exam.

The demand for skilled project managers continues to rise as organizations prioritize efficient project execution to remain competitive. According to the (PMI), the global economy will create 25 million new project management-oriented jobs by 2030. With industries relying heavily on project management expertise, earning a certification in this field positions you to stand out in this competitive landscape.Ìý
Project management skills are critical across various sectors, including technology, healthcare, finance, marketing, and more. Earning a project management certification is a quick and financially reasonable way to achieve industry-relevant skills and grow your career opportunities.Ìý
